I just got a new Google Nest Hub Max for a present for my mother. Before finishing the set up it started rebooting by itself. At the beginning it was every hour but after 2 days it's almost every 5m. Did I miss something? I restored the factory settings and started the set up again without any difference.

The power connector on the Max can seem to be inserted when it isn't fully engaged. Press on it a bit and see if you don't hear a little snap when it clicks in. If that doesn't help, try plugging in the adapter elsewhere to see if you are dealing with a bad outlet or circuit.
